I haven't had a single issue with either of my Vacuflush units until now. I tried going through the troubleshooting steps from the manual but I'm still not certain which issue i have. I thought if I posted the specifics, one of you vac-u-flush-experts could weigh in with some additional tests to run and/or help isolate the mostly likely cause.

Here's a picture of the unit I'm having trouble with for reference https://www.dropbox.com/s/t4lcsi6q0fi84mb/stbd-vacuflush.jpg

- Port unit works fine
- Stbd unit takes water in, but no vacuum is present.
- I shorted the sensor switch with a wire and the unit engages but I think it's just pumping air.
- After shorting the switch there IS a vacuum at the head but only for 1, maybe 2 flushes, then back to no vacuum.
- I've read about replacing a Bill Valve but have no idea if that's the problem and where those valves are.
- If it's a clog, what's more likely -- the input elbow or the output from the pump to the tank?
- I haven't run a snake into the hose after the head but I could.
- If it's the sensor switch (where I shorted) how to determine that versus a clog?

The unit worked fine two weeks ago though it didn't get that much usage.

Well there only would be vacuum for about one flush each time the unit is flushed if everything is working properly. So it's no surprise that you only get one flush out of it where you force it to make vacuum.

When you manually make vacuum does the system hold vacuum? If so for how long?

You say you think the unit may be clogged. But when you make vacuum manually does the head flush properly? Or does it act clogged?

The duck bills are located on each side of the diaphragm vacuum pump.

If it is a clogged before the accumulator the pump will labor more because vacuum has already been established. It could be clogged after the tank but I would expect the pump to labor or hydrostatic lock after several pumps? If the switch is gone, the pump will not labor and vacuum will be generated when jumped. Given it seems the pump runs normally when the switch is jumped I'll bet it's the switch.
Without vacuum in the system the waste will pile up in the lines until good vacuum pulls it to the accumulator. Then when you flush again you will hear it all move.

If the pump does not run for a normal cycle after a flush it's the switch. If it runs on and on but there is no vacuum there is a leak or bad valves.

- Port unit works fine
>> irrelevant if they are on different pumps / vac gen

- Stbd unit takes water in, but no vacuum is present.
>> water comes from your fresh water system thru a simple valve! not affected by vacuum

- I shorted the sensor switch with a wire and the unit engages but I think it's just pumping air.
>> well it s a vacuum pump, it is supposed to pump air, mostly,..:)

- After shorting the switch there IS a vacuum at the head but only for 1, maybe 2 flushes, then back to no vacuum.
>> thre can only be vacuum for one flush

- I've read about replacing a Bill Valve but have no idea if that's the problem and where those valves are.
>> if when bypassing the switch you get vacuum it s unlikely to be the duck bills. Th duck bills are at the pump inlet and outlet, two of them. Clearly shown in the manual

- If it's a clog, what's more likely -- the input elbow or the output from the pump to the tank?
>> can be anywhere... First check the bottom of th head where the Venturi is, by holding the pedal down. If you don't see anything there it could be at the elbow coming into the vac tank. Either way, the pump will build vacuum into the tank and shut down.

- I haven't run a snake into the hose after the head but I could.

- If it's the sensor switch (where I shorted) how to determine that versus a clog?
>> if you bypass the switch manually for about 30 seconds and then it flushes right, it s not clogged but the switch, if after bypassing the switch you don't hear air when flushing, and water just sits there, it s a clogged.

Note that you don't have to bypass or short the switch, you can just pull on th rod to trigger switch, if you have a clog this is an easy way to increase vaccum and possibly clear it. I can't figure out how to embed an image so here is a picture of what I have used many times to clear a minor clog...if the pump runs.

https://www.dropbox.com/s/ylfqankgt5kx5hy/Unplugger.JPG

Cut off water supply, empty bowl, hold pedal down to open the exit hole, turn the pump on and stick this thing down there tight and start pulsing dock water through it.

to the OP, it is very unlikely you have a clog between the head and the vacuum pump as the port at the bottom of the head is much smaller in diameter than the 2" line connecting the head to the pump.

my advice is to go after the low hanging fruit first. next to the vacuum pump will be a vacuum switch, these can fail over time and its easy to see if the switch is bad by simply bypassing the switch and see if the pump is working.

if you have not changed the duck bill valves yet, start there. they are located on the in/out side of each vacuum pump and there are 4 on each pump. they are in expensive and easy to swap out.

I returned to the pump and tried one more test - under the switch, I depressed the rod that is spring loaded which should engage the switch without shorting across the terminals (the way I see it) but it didn't work. So, I checked one more time that shorting engages the pump and it does. So, I pulled the switch and ordered a new one. I think that should do it.
